Abstract: Pressure vessels and piping systems have received an extraordinary amount of attention in recent years. Even storage tanks at atmospheric pressure have been more heavily scrutinized by the Occupational Safety and Health Administration (OSHA, United States), the Environmental Protection Association (EPA, United States) and industries in general. The design engineer is facing a multitude of adverbs when considering the best approach to a pressure vessel design, piping design or system design program to select the appropriate code, material, orientation, shape etc. This project aims to design a two saddle supported horizontal cylindrical tank for hydraulic system in Cold Roll Skin Pass Mill at Essar Steel, Hazira.Here main function of tank is to, store and supply the oil to the system continuously.ASME section VIII div I is followed considering storage tank as low pressure pressure vessel and design is done using horizontal cylindrical shell with both end closed with ellipsoidal heads.Saddle design is referred from standard design available in pressure vessel handbook and modify the design for material saving. Both the tank and saddle is modeled in Creo Parametric 2.0 and finite element analyses of saddle is done in ANSYS 14.0.
